“We demolish arguments and every pretension that sets itself up against the knowledge of God, and we take captive every thought to make it obedient to Christ.”
2 Corinthians 10:5 (NIV)

This week’s prayer emphasis will focus on praying about our thoughts as we follow God’s instructions to take every one of them captive.  We are each shaped by the things which enter our mind, and especially by those things that we allow our thoughts to dwell upon.  While it is impossible to shield ourselves completely from the arguments and pretensions which are opposed to Christ, with the help of God’s Spirit we can take captive every thought so that our actions would more accurately reflect Christ.

As you pray this week, ask God to help you be aware of everything that enters your mind.  Pray that each thought would be evaluated and dealt with in a way that is obedient to Christ.  Pray each day that you would choose to set your mind on things above so that the ways of God become the standard by which you take each thought captive.
